一般描述

脱钙溶液-Lite旨在作为一种普遍有效的脱钙剂。

应用

脱钙溶液— Lite 预期用于常规、免疫组织化学和骨髓核心标本的脱钙。
它同样适用于所有类型的样本,包括易于处理的时间框架内的颅骨样本。
